Output c03e24d05caf33ddb39e7f612434b7eef951e82fb53deba9c69a37772e67e9ea:3

value
10167058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ca7dcd710664abc7aed16aa1208f9ded5962ffe8 OP_EQUAL
address
3L9h8CqMQqDrdPvcVQsf3CaU4H8SUGSJks
transaction
c03e24d05caf33ddb39e7f612434b7eef951e82fb53deba9c69a37772e67e9ea
confirmations
297358
spent
true